Governors elected under the PDP governors forum on the platform of the Peoples Democratic Party, have called an emergency meeting in Abuja on Sunday to discuss the future in light of the recent wave of defections in the main opposition party.

According to reports, the PDP has had a difficult two weeks as members have continued to leave for the ruling All Progressives Congress, or APC.

The latest wave started on April 23 when Sheriff Oborevwori, the governor of Delta State, led Ifeanyi Okowa, his predecessor, and the entire PDP apparatus in the state to defect to the ruling party.

Their defection occurred just one week after the governors met in the capital of Oyo State, Ibadan, and stated that they would be open to any coalition discussions before the general elections in 2027.
